Cheap - you get what you pay for.
The boxes at my local Home Depot for this product looked like they'd been kicked from New York to Florida, and unfortunately they looked like that for all of the boxes of this product. This was the one I liked though, and the price was right for my budget.
I should've just paid $100 for a decent fixture. This one is terrible.
1 - Buy your own hardware. Don't even bother using the stuff they give you because it's cheap.
2 - The two long screws that attach the front to the mounting plate were too small for the decorative nuts that were supposed to hold it together. I kept turning and turning and turning and they never tightened. I finally dug around in one of our tool drawers and used two silver nuts. Normally I'd take it back but I'd been painting the bedroom, bathroom, and trim for two days and I was tired. I was ready to be done.
3 - The arms for the lights are crooked. When you get the shades on there, it's quite noticeable.
4 - The light sockets inside the arms are crooked, making it hard to tighten the shades in there.
Do yourselves a favor and just pay the money for a nicer fixture. Mine is staying until I have the urge and the money to do this again.
